Protecting Yourself from False Claims

In a world inundated with misinformation, it’s essential to be vigilant and critical of the information we consume on social media. Here are some tips to help protect yourself from false claims:

– Verify information from multiple reliable sources before sharing it online.
– Look out for warning signs of misinformation, such as sensational headlines or unverified claims.
– Report false claims to the social media platform and encourage others to do the same.
